How much do remote chemical process eng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 16,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ote chemical process engineer in Nebraska is $96,607.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$78,700.00 and $109,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some typical daily responsibilities for a Remote Chemical Process Engineer?

As a Remote Chemical Process Engineer, your day-to-day tasks often include analyzing process data, designing or optimizing chemical processes, creating technical documentation, and troubleshooting operational issues. You'll regularly use process simulation software and collaborate virtually with cross-functional teams such as project managers, plant operators, and safety specialists. Participation in virtual meetings, providing technical support, and ensuring compliance with safety and environmental regulations are also common parts of the job. This role requires managing your own schedule efficiently while staying responsive to the needs of both internal and external stakeholders.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Remote Chemical Process Engineer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Chemical Process Engineer, you need a solid background in chemical engineering principles, process design, and troubleshooting, typically supported by a relevant engineering degree and professional certifications like a PE or EIT. Familiarity with process simulation software (such as Aspen Plus or HYSYS), data analysis tools, and remote collaboration platforms is important. Strong problem-solving skills, effective time management, and clear communication are essential for working autonomously and collaborating with distributed teams. These skills ensure efficient process optimization, regulatory compliance, and seamless teamwork despite remote work settings.

What is a Remote Chemical Process Engineer job?

A Remote Chemical Process Engineer designs, analyzes, and optimizes chemical manufacturing processes while working from a remote location. They use simulation software, data analysis, and virtual collaboration tools to improve efficiency, safety, and sustainability in chemical production. Responsibilities may include process design, troubleshooting, scaling operations, and ensuring regulatory compliance. Remote engineers often coordinate with on-site teams, suppliers, and clients through digital communication. This role requires strong problem-solving skills and expertise in chemical engineering principles to enhance industrial processes effectively.

About the Team and Role:

We’re hiring our first AI Automation Engineer to lead how we apply AI internally across the company. This is a unique opportunity to shape how LLMs become embedded in our daily operations. Your goal will be to automate as much work as possible, increasing our productivity and improving the quality of our products, decision-making, and internal processes.

You’ll work closely with teams across the organization to identify high-impact problems and solve them, continually assessing new potential as frontier model capabilities constantly improve. With access to a wide range of state-of-the-art models via Poe, and an organization focused on AI, you’ll be well placed to experiment, iterate quickly, and launch internal services.

This role is ideal for an engineer who’s curious, pragmatic, and motivated by real-world impact - not just research or prototypes. You’ll lay the groundwork for how we approach internal AI applications, with a focus on utility, trust, and constant adaptation.

Responsibilities:
  • Develop and maintain internal tools and systems that automate existing work and increase employee productivity using AI
  • Use AI as much as possible to automate your own process of creating this software
  • Collaborate with teams across the business to understand pain points and identify high-impact automation or process improvement opportunities
  • Rapidly prototype small AI-enabled utilities or automations and deploy them into production swiftly
  • Supervise the choices AI is making in areas like architecture, libraries, or technologies, and be ready to debug complex systems across frontend and backend services when AI cannot
  • Act as a high-trust owner of systems that may handle sensitive data or business-critical logic
  • Work cross-functionally to ensure tools are adopted and deliver obvious value
  • Stay updated on the latest models and tools, and apply that knowledge to your work
Minimum Requirements:
  • Availability for meetings and impromptu communication during Quora's “ coordination hours " (Mon-Fri: 9am-3pm Pacific Time)
  • Experience creating LLM-backed tools involving prompt engineering and automated evals
  • 5+ years of experience in full-stack development with strong skills in Python, React and JavaScript
  • Excellent debugging skills and the 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ously
  • High level of ownership and accountability, especially with sensitive or business-critical data
  • Strong communication skills and a collaborative mindset
  • Comfortable working in a fast-paced, sometimes ambiguous environment with shifting priorities
  • Experience working cross-functionally with teams outside of product development
  • A natural collaborator who enjoys being a partner and creating utility for others
